為什么要統一管理微服務配置? 隨着微服務不斷的增多,每個微服務都有自己對應的配置文件。在研發過程中有測試環境、UAT環境、生產環境,因此每個微服務又對應至少三個不同環境的配置文件。這么多的配置文件,如果需要修改某個公共服務的配置信息,如:緩存、數據庫等,難免會產生混亂 ...
概述 分布式系統面臨的問題 微服務意味着要將單體應用中的業務拆分成一個個的子服務,這些服務都需要必要的配置信息才能運行,如果有上百個微服務,上百個配置文件,管理起來是非常困難的,這時候,一套集中式的 動態的配置管理中心是必不可少的,Spring Cloud 提供了 ConfigServer 來解決這個問題。 是什么 Spring Cloud Config 為微服務提供了集中化的外部配置支持,配置服 ...
2020-04-26 15:18 2 674 推薦指數:
為什么要統一管理微服務配置? 隨着微服務不斷的增多,每個微服務都有自己對應的配置文件。在研發過程中有測試環境、UAT環境、生產環境,因此每個微服務又對應至少三個不同環境的配置文件。這么多的配置文件,如果需要修改某個公共服務的配置信息,如:緩存、數據庫等,難免會產生混亂 ...
一、基本使用 1. Config-Server端 (1)pom: parent依賴 dependencyManagement dependencies ...
Config 分布式配置中心 概述 微服務意味着要將單體應用中的業務拆分成個個子服務,每個服務的粒度相對較小因此系統中會出現大量的服務 由於每個服務都需要必要的配置信息才能運行,所以一套集中式的、動態的配置管理設施是必不可少的 Spring Cloud提供了 ConfigServer 來解決 ...
也稱為分布式配置中心,它是一個獨立的微服務應用,用來連接配置服務器並為客戶端提供獲取配置信息, 加密/解 ...
1、簡介 Spring Cloud Config :分布式配置中心,方便服務配置文件統一管理,它支持配置服務放在配置服務的內存中(即本地),也支持放在遠程Git倉庫中。在spring cloud config 組件中,分兩個角色,一是config server,二是config client ...
前言 重構成微服務后,每個服務都需要部署很多個實例,在修改配置時不可能每個實例手動去修改,因此使用springboot-config。本想使用git,還是由於公司內部問題只能使用svn,記錄下搭建配置中心的過程 創建SVN目錄上傳配置 這步驟就不細說...最終的目錄為http ...
Spring Cloud Config 簡介 Spring Cloud Config為分布式系統中的外部化配置提供服務器和客戶端支持。使用Config Server,您可以在所有環境中管理應用程序的外部屬性。客戶端和服務器上的概念映射與Spring Environment ...
前言: 必需學會SpringBoot基礎知識 簡介: spring cloud 為開發人員提供了快速構建分布式系統的一些工具,包括配置管理、服務發現、斷路器、路由、微代理、事件總線、全局鎖、決策競選、分布式會話等等。它運行環境簡單,可以在開發人員的電腦上跑。 工具 ...